Вверх ↑
Ответов: 16884
Рейтинг: 1239
#1: 2013-12-02 10:53:58 ЛС | профиль | цитата
2. Понял.
1. Нужно добавить то, что выделено:
Select NameStreets From Streets Where id_NameStreets in (Select NameStreets From Table_Infor WHERE Id_UserName=%1);

Вот это (в той схеме выше) у меня прекрасно работает:
SELECT name FROM streets WHERE id in (SELECT Streets FROM infor WHERE User=4);

Только нужно иметь ввиду, что такой запрос хитро работает:
если у твоего Id_UserName одна и та же улица повторяется несколько раз, то в результате запроса она отразится только ОДИН раз.

Kazbek17 писал(а):
ваш пример не работает почему то.
Причину неудач ищи у себя.
Подождём. Может ещё кто-то захочет посмотреть.
карма: 25
Немного терпения! Дежурный экстрасенс скоро свяжется с Вами!
0